I can't vouch for the section numbers and I can't promise that MATH115 hasn't changed a bit, but I figured these notes might be useful to someone.MATH 241 is the third semester of the calculus sequence for Mathematics, Physical Sciences, and Engineering majors. It deals with functions of several variables, and is more geometric in spirit than the earlier courses in this sequence. ... Department of Mathematics University of Maryland

MATH241. Calculus III. Syllabus Repository (3) Credits: 4. : Prerequisite: Minimum grade of C- in MATH141. Credit only granted for: MATH241 or …Answer: The vector field is tangential to circles. If we move around a circle in the direction of the arrows, the function f would have to keep increasing (since grad f = F). But when we arrive at the starting point we must have the same value again - this is a contradiction! syms x y z.
